Transaction 166ee2bc3491963782c65ba198ff9d9b11c92c5622ea6ae0cf999cc03b86ec45
1 Input
1 Output
-
166ee2bc3491963782c65ba198ff9d9b11c92c5622ea6ae0cf999cc03b86ec45:0
- value
- 172090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5fe1e612004706e1ee1a31819144f27496854c9 OP_EQUAL
- address
- 3Nf75wv2yNvK729sDcfRB7LkmjVqvHQwjz